Ferdinand Scheminzky
Ferdinand Scheminzky (born February 17, 1899 in Vienna , † June 9, 1973 in Innsbruck ) was an Austrian physiologist and balneologist . From 1936 to 1938 he was entrusted with the management of the Gastein Research Institute . From 1945 he was given this function again.
Fonts
- Guide to Physiological Exercises , 1930
- The world of sound , 1935
- Health resorts and mineral science, 1947ff. (Book series)
- Journal of Physical Therapy, Bath and Climate Medicine , 1948–50 (Ed. With J. Kowarschik)
- Mineral Spring Biology , 1962
- The Badgastein-Böckstein thermal tunnel , 1965 (ed.)
- Spa therapy in Austria , 1969
